Góry są źródłami dla ludzi, rzek, lodowców i żyznej ziemi. Wielcy poeci, filozofowie, prorocy, zdolni ludzie, których myśli i czyny poruszyły świat, zstąpili z gór.

The mountains are fountains of men as well as of rivers, of glaciers, and of fertile soil. The great poets, philosophers, prophets, able men whose thoughts and deeds have moved the world, have come down from the mountains.
